Toyota has added the GR Yaris to a new OEM tuning program that enables drivers in Japan to opt for a complex software upgrade adding 20 Nm (15 lb-ft) of torque and improving overall throttle response.
The Japan-spec GR Yaris utilizes a 1.6-liter turbo mill rated at 272 PS (268 hp / 200 kW) and 370 Nm (273 lb-ft) of torque. Paying a rough equivalent of 1,000 USD extra gets you to 390 Nm (288 lb-ft) at the same power. More importantly, though, the entire throttle response curve is improved this way with the peak torque accessible between 3,200 and 4,000 RPM, a much wider window than before.
As well, buyers of the GR Yaris can request tweaks affecting per-axle distribution of torque and handling. The list includes a total of 27 settings drivers in Japan can customize to match their preferences perfectly. Toyota stresses that a consultation with a drivetrain specialist is required before ordering to make sure there is a clear understanding of the details.
